Now changing, however, thanks to more users on the forum aicjofs XBMC, which ripped apart a fresh unit to find out exactly what is inside its shell. In addition to its documented A5 single core SoC, now it is confirmed that the pendant features 1080p-so-branded Hynix 512MB RAM (up from 256) with 8GB of storage with no change, owned by Toshiba. Interestingly, there was no word on whether it is packing Bluetooth 2.1 + EDR as the other 2010 (Apple website only lists 802.11a/b/g/n WiFi), but mentioned that aicjofs MacRumors has discovered what may be an additional WiFi antenna.
